The Belgium Rabies Vaccine Market focuses on vaccines that prevent rabies, a fatal viral infection. This market is vital for public health, ensuring the availability of vaccines for both humans and animals.
The rabies vaccine market in Belgium is influenced by the need for effective vaccination programs to prevent and control rabies, a deadly viral disease. The increasing awareness of rabies prevention and the rise in vaccination campaigns support market growth. Rabies vaccines are essential for protecting both humans and animals from the disease. Technological advancements in vaccine development and the introduction of new vaccine formulations contribute to market expansion. Additionally, the growing emphasis on public health and the need for global vaccination initiatives drive market dynamics.
Challenges in the rabies vaccine market include managing the high cost of vaccine production and ensuring the availability of vaccines in sufficient quantities. Regulatory compliance and addressing concerns related to vaccine safety and efficacy are crucial. The market is also influenced by the prevalence of rabies and public health initiatives.
The Belgian government regulates the rabies vaccine market to ensure the safety and efficacy of vaccines used for both human and animal health. Policies include standards for vaccine production, distribution, and administration to prevent rabies outbreaks and protect public health. The government also supports vaccination programs and research to improve rabies prevention and control.
